Summary
"Argentina is the largest country in the world that has Spanish as its main language. This and other fun facts are waiting for readers to discover as they explore the places and people that make this South American nation unique. From its government and environment to its arts and food, each aspect of life in Argentina is the subject of a focused chapter that features the latest facts and vibrant photographs. Fact boxes and maps provide additional insight, and sidebars put a spotlight on Argentinian citizens who are shining examples of global citizenship"--, Provided by publisher
